Vice President — Michigan — Robotics / Automation. Japanese Speaking skills a major benefit.
We are seeking a dynamic and strategic Vice President to lead our clients US operations and drive aggressive growth in the world’s largest robotics and automation market. This executive will be responsible for crafting and executing the national business strategy, encompassing sales, marketing, and operational excellence. The ideal candidate will be a visionary leader with a proven track record of scaling industrial technology businesses, building high-performance teams, and establishing a dominant market presence.
This role is pivotal to achieving market leadership ambitions in the US.
- Strategic Leadership & P&L Management: Develop and implement the comprehensive US business strategy to achieve revenue, profitability, and market share objectives. Own P&L responsibility for the US region.
- Revenue Growth & Market Expansion: Drive all sales activities, including direct sales, key account management, and channel partner development. Identify and penetrate new vertical markets and applications to expand customer base.
- Team Building & Organizational Development: Recruit, mentor, and lead a high-caliber team across sales, applications engineering, service, and administrative functions. Foster a culture of excellence, collaboration, and customer-centricity.
- Customer & Partner Ecosystem: Serve as the ultimate point of escalation for key customers and strategic partners.
- Market Positioning & Brand Development: Collaborate with global marketing to tailor and execute powerful marketing and branding initiatives for the US market. Position the company as a premier technology and solutions provider.
- Cross-Functional Collaboration: Work closely with global product development, engineering, and manufacturing teams to represent US market needs and influence product roadmap and service offerings.
- Industry Advocacy: Represent the company at major industry events, trade associations, and with key media to enhance thought leadership and market visibility.
